Grammar Is It Bit or Bitten? Understanding the Past Tense of "Bite" By Khamis 18 December 2023 " Bit " is the simple past tense of "bite," indicating a completed action. " Bitten " is the past participle form of "bite," used with auxiliary verbs or for the passive voice.

Answer The past tense of bite is bit . The third-person singular simple present indicative form of bite is bites . The present participle of bite is biting . The past participle of bite is bitten or bit (informal in US, archaic in Britain) . Find more words! bite Similar Words champed chewed chewn crunched chomped crushed gnawed gnew gnawn

The verb "bite" is an irregular verb. (This means that "bite" does not form its simple past tense or its past participle by adding "-ed" or "-d" to the base form.)
